2006 Ford 500 problems

Verdict · NHTSA data

Worth extra scrutiny

The 2006 Ford 500 sits mid-pack among 500 years: 105 NHTSA complaints against a model median of roughly 78, with no recalls and no defect investigations.

No single system dominates the record — complaints spread across speed control (24), transmission (20), and engine (17), which usually points to general build quality rather than one defect.

Consumer complaints filed with NHTSA

Representative excerpts, cleaned of personal information. These are consumer statements, not verified defects.

TL* THE CONTACT OWNS A 2006 FORD 500. WHILE DRIVING 34 MPH, THE VEHICLE ACCELERATED INDEPENDENTLY AND THE ENGINE STALLED. THE VEHICLE WAS TOWED TO AN INDEPENDENT MECHANIC WHO DIAGNOSED THAT THE THROTTLE BODY NEEDED TO BE REPLACED. THE VEHICLE WAS NOT REPAIRED. THE MANUFACTURER WAS NOTIFIED OF THE…

Complaint filed with NHTSA · Speed Control · October 22, 2014

FIRST NOTICED WHEN I WAS IN LINE AT A DRIVE THROUGH CAR WOULD JUMP FORWARD. IT IS GETTING WORSE AS I WAS BACKING OUT OF PARKING LOT AT THE GROCERY STORE CAR JUMPED FELT LIKE THE ACCLERATOR WAS STUCK, I HIT MY BRAKE AND IT FELT AS IF IT WENT TO THE FLOOR. I ALMOST HIT ANOTHER CAR THANK GOD THERE WAS…

Complaint filed with NHTSA · Transmission · July 31, 2014

EXPERIENCE MOMENTARY, INTERMITTENT ENGINE IDLE RPM SURGE (IDLE FLARE) WHEN STOPPED, DURING LOW SPEED DRIVING MANEUVERS AND TURNING ON A/C SUCH AS IN A PARKING LOT OR DRIVEWAY. UNSTABLE IDLE SPEED. *TR

Complaint filed with NHTSA · Engine · July 18, 2012 · crash

WHILE STARTING MY CAR ( PARKED ) WITH THE FRONT PASSENGER WINDOW DOWN SMOKE BEGAN TO APPEAR FROM BEHIND THE PASSENGER REAR VIEW WINDOW. I SAW A FLAME ( FIRE ) APPEAR FROM BEHIND THE PASSENGER REAR VIEW MIRROR. WHEN I TURNED OFF THE VEHICLE THE FLAME WENT OUT. AFTER THE FIRE NONE OF THE WINDOWS WILL…

Complaint filed with NHTSA · Electrical System · February 10, 2018 · fire

THE ENGINE DIED, MEANING NO ACCELERATION. I RESTARTED THE ENGINE AFTER A REST AND IT STARTED AND DROVE AGAIN. IT HAPPENED AGAIN LATER THAT DAY AND I NOTICED THAT THE RPMS SURGED JUST BEFORE THE ENGINE DIED. I TOOK IT TO AUTOZONE TO GET THE CODES FROM THE COMPUTER, AND THE CODES ARE P2111 AND P2104.…

Complaint filed with NHTSA · Fuel System · July 2, 2015

2006 Ford 500 — common questions

Is the 2006 Ford 500 reliable?

It is close to typical for the 500: 105 NHTSA complaints, 0 recalls, and no investigations on file.

What are the most common 2006 500 problems?

According to NHTSA complaint data, the leading problem areas are speed control (24 complaints), transmission (20 complaints), engine (17 complaints).

Does the 2006 Ford 500 have recalls?

No. NHTSA lists no recall campaigns for the 2006 Ford 500.
